Life Insurers Express Concerns Over Financial Burden from Reduced Issuance of Ultra-Long-Term Bonds
Life insurance companies have conveyed to financial authorities that the reduction in the issuance of ultra-long-term government bonds could increase their financial soundness burden. Concerns have been raised that a decrease in the supply of ultra-long-term bonds may impact asset-liability management (ALM) plans. While life insurers stated that a reduction in issuance volume is acceptable, adjustments beyond the anticipated range could pose a burden. Ultra-long-term bonds are necessary to match the maturities of assets and liabilities in line with long-term insurance contracts. The government has proposed that the proportion of bonds issued with maturities over 20 years should be 35%±5%, and life insurers are planning to purchase long-term bonds in accordance with this range. However, if the issuance is reduced, insurance companies may compete to secure the necessary volume, which could lower the interest rates on long-term bonds. Conversely, if market interest rates decline, the discount rate used for evaluating insurance liabilities may also decrease, potentially lowering the solvency ratio (K-ICS). Financial authorities are demanding that insurance companies manage their interest rate sensitivity, and regulations on duration gaps are set to be introduced in 2027. Discussions on ultra-long-term bonds are related to the global rise in long-term interest rates, with the domestic 30-year government bond rate recently surpassing 4.7%.
